    A 10 year old Glen Moray from the Scotch Malt Whisky Society, distilled in 2012, from cask 35.341, bottled at 60.6%, one of 188 bottles. Glen Moray is a Speyside single malt from Elgin, known for its light, fruity and accessible style. Its water is drawn from the River Lossie, which runs past the distillery at Elgin.

    Run through the stills on River Lossie water for a light make, for a clean make of orchard fruit and a soft honey. An ex-Bourbon barrel shaped it, vanillin lending vanilla under the apple. Through integration spirit and wood marry, vanillin settling into a rounded vanilla as ethyl esters lend a riper apple and pear. Years in oak round the spirit, the green apple deepening to honey and dried fruit. The light, fruity make takes cask flavour well while keeping its apple and pear. Its light, fresh spirit suits a wide range of cask finishes, from sherry to rum.

    At its natural 60.6% it is concentrated. A clean, fruity sweetness, with a soft vanilla from the oak. The texture is light and clean, the fruit lifted by vanilla. The finish is long, fruity and clean. This is Glen Moray's clean, accessible Speyside style.
